Despite the fact that they had technically only just gotten up a few hours ago, both Bethany and Benjamin fell asleep on the car ride home. Their parents quietly undressed them and tucked them into bed, grateful for a little quiet alone time.
"Are you hungry?" Jackie asked, half whispering, as Daniel came down the stairs, still rubbing shower water out of his hair.
"Yeah" he answered. Jackie handed him a plate.
"Macaroni and Cheese?" Daniel asked with a smile as he took the plate and headed to the couch.
"After all that stuff at Rya'c's wedding, it sounded simply divine" his wife answered, "Simple being the key word" She joined him on the couch, pulling her feet up and curling into him.
"Has it ever occurred to you, Danny, that we lead charmed lives?" she asked.
"What do you mean?" Daniel inquired.
"We have two beautiful children, wonderful family, loyal friends, a nice house, the best jobs to be had on the planet" and then she grinned up at him as she pointed the remote at the television, "And Simpsons whenever we want them" Daniel had to laugh even as he took her point. He supposed they did lead nearly perfect lives, especially now that the Goa'uld were under control. Even with the occasional risks and nearly fatal disasters, he wouldn't change anything in his life. After so many years on SG-1, the occasional disaster kept him from getting bored.
He put an arm around his perfect wife, and settled back to enjoy his perfect life.
"Back to the daily grind" Jack muttered to Daniel as they entered the briefing room together. Daniel lifted his eyebrows tiredly and sipped his coffee. Sam, Jackie and Colonel Moorison, who had been in charge during Jack's absence, were already seated around the table.
"Good morning, campers" Jack said as he took his seat, "Everybody rested and relaxed?"
"What is it about vacations that makes one so...tired?" Daniel replied with another sip from his coffee.
"I think they're called children, Daniel" Sam answered with a smile.
"Well, shall we get to it then?" Jack nodded at them. Jackie raised her hand in a salute.
"Ready when you are, fearless leader" she said. It was a morning routine of theirs, joking around in that incorrigible way of theirs.
"Daniel, what've you got?" the General asked. Daniel flipped his folder open and leafed through a couple of pages.
"We still haven't translated all of the markings on the device brought back by SG-11" he answered, "But we're getting close"
"How close?" Jack asked.
"Uh, well...actually, we haven't translated any of it yet" Daniel answered.
"Daniel! You've had that thing for almost three months now! I thought you said you knew what language it was!"
"I know, Jack" Daniel replied, "The problem is the syntax, the sentence structure. We're working on it" Jack swiveled slightly towards his wife.
"Sam?"
"Well, actually, we're finished. We're ready to send it to Norad" she answered.
"You can rebuild it?" Jack inquired.
"Yes, but I don't know if there would be any point" Sam told him. He raised an eyebrow.
"Oh? Why not?"
"It's a...hand held lighting device" she replied.
"A flashlight?" Jack interpreted.
"Well, that'll come in handy. You know...when it's dark" Jackie commented. Her brother gave her an annoyed look.
"I know the device itself isn't anything special, but its power source may be" Sam continued, "It's like a battery that never dies. If we can figure out a way to make a bigger one, the technology could have countless uses."
"Ah. Well, that's good news" Jack turned his attention to his younger sister, "And you, Mrs. Jackson?" Jackie stuck her tongue out at him. In a facility where everyone had a rank, and without even the stature of a doctorate, she hated having her own title used. And he knew it. Which was why he used it whenever she was out of hitting range.
"I'm still working on the Ma'chello stuff" she answered, "I got through the first layer, but I think there are probably another couple layers in there"
"How do you do that?" Sam asked, giving her sister-in-law an impressed look, "It's a completely unique code. There's nothing to even compare it to!"
"You should see the stuff she writes when she's bored" Daniel told his sister-in-law, "They're uncrackable"
"Now, that's hard to imagine" Jack quipped.
"What? Me writing uncrackable codes?" Jackie inquired, a phony look of pain on her face.
"No" Jack said, "You being bored" Jackie laughed.
"Every code has its little clues. Backdoors for people who know how to use them. Anyway, give me another couple weeks. I'll get it"
"Too bad you weren't around back when we really could've used that technology against the Goa'uld" Sam said. Jackie shrugged at her friend.
"What about you, Moorison?" Jack asked the last member of the briefing, "Anything interesting happen while I was gone?"
"SG-4 reported they may have found a new source of naquida, sir" Moorison replied, "Other than that..."
"Excuse me" Sgt. Davis said, as he came up the stairs, "Sorry to interrupt. Bransford Elementary and the daycare just called. They said Benjamin, Bethany and Alexis all got sick"
The parents exchanged looks. Ordinary life intruded on their galaxy sized lives again.
"I'll go" Jackie offered, rising from her chair, "I'll take this stuff home with me"
"I hope they didn't catch anything on Chulak" Sam commented.
"Nah. It's probably just something they ate" Jackie conjectured. She bent and gave Daniel a quick kiss and then headed for the door.
"Call me if you need me!" she told them as she left.
Later that night Daniel was trying hard to be quiet as he closed the garage door to the kitchen. The entire downstairs was dark and he could hardly see where he was going, which is why he crashed right into a kitchen chair that hadn't gotten pushed in. A light turned on above the stairs and Jackie came down.
"Danny?" she called softly.
"Yeah" Daniel replied, flicking the kitchen light on. Apparently the kids were upstairs and not on the couch as he had guessed.
"Where've you been?" Jackie chided, "Sam came to pick Alexis up hours ago"
"Jack sent her home early" Daniel told her, rubbing his shin. Jackie pulled an ice pack out of the freezer and handed it to him.
"He didn't want her over working herself"
"He worries too much" his wife complained, "Sam knows when to quit"
"Yeah, just about as much as you"
"What's that supposed to mean?" Jackie asked as they headed upstairs.
"I had to practically drag you out of your office when you were pregnant with Benjamin!" Daniel reminded her.
"Oh you did not" Jackie replied, crawling into bed as he undressed, "And anyway, it's not as if I was doing hard work or anything" Daniel chose not to respond. There was no use arguing with her anyway. He pulled his pajamas on and crawled into bed next to her.
"So, did you guys miss me at work today?" she asked.
"Desperately" Daniel replied with a smile, "How're the kids?"
"Fine. They just aren't used to eating so much, and all that Jaffa food too. It's so rich"
"Mmmm"
"Did I miss anything fun?" Jackie questioned.
"Teal'c came back" Daniel told her. She sat up on her elbows.
"What?"
"Apparently Rya'c told him he could do things himself and sent him home" Daniel told her what Teal'c had said when he'd come through the stargate two days ahead of schedule.
"Oh and we got a call from Moog" Daniel added. Jackie moaned and let her head drop back into the pillows.
"He's coming tomorrow" her husband alerted her. Jackie pulled the covers up over her head.
"I can't stand that little creep" she whined, "He makes me feel sick to my stomach. Literally"
"I know. He bugs me too, but they are our allies. We can't just lock the door and pretend we're not home" her husband said. Jackie flipped the covers back and sighed.
"Fine. Then I'm going in with you tomorrow morning" she said.
"Why?"
"He always asks for the same things, Danny" she replied, "They want the Protector, we tell them no, they want the necklace, we tell them no, they want me, we tell them no and then he wants to shake my hand again. This time, we're skipping all the rigamara, I'm shaking his hand and he's leaving. He'll be on planet for ten minutes, if we're lucky" Daniel shook his head and turned off the light.
